Does my child have to be registered for Summer Reading & Learning to attend events?

No. Everyone is welcome!

Do I need to pay anything to attend events?

No. All library events are free and open to the public!

Do I need a ticket for my child to attend special events?

Our special events on Wednesdays and Thursdays are limited capacity. Tickets are required and will be available on a first come, first served basis at the Youth Services desk beginning one hour before each event. These events are marked below with an asterisk (*).

ART OF BEING LITTLE STORYTIMES

Young children and their caregivers are invited to participate in an interactive program that incorporates books, songs, and movement to encourage pre-reading skills.

Tuesdays at 10:30 am in Storytime Station

Wednesdays at 10:30 am in Bowie-Segraves Park

 

ART OF BEING LITTLE THURSDAYS

Young children and their caregivers are invited to participate in a variety of programs designed especially with our birth to five children in mind. Expect all the Super Tots fun you love during the school year with an on-theme name for the summer. 

Thursdays at 10:30 am
